Leadership Review Briefing — Kestrelgate Reseller Programme

Quick one for heads of department: the Kestrelgate programme added nine partners this quarter, mostly in the Aldmere corridor. Margins are holding, churn is low, and Selwyn Dray wants budget to expand training. We'll debate the expansion case at Thursday's review. The confidential note on our forward plans sits directly below.

management briefing: Jorixax Holdings is in early talks to buy Casixax Holdings for about $420.3 million. The Fenmir launch date is October 27, and nothing goes to the press before then. Legal wants the Keloxek Foods term sheet redrafted before April 16.

# Tollgate Consent Banner — Environments

The Tollgate consent banner rolls out across three environments: sandbox, preview, and production. Sandbox disables consent persistence entirely; preview stores choices in Varnholt-region storage only; production enforces regional residency. Reviewers should confirm that logging excludes pre-consent identifiers. Each environment's enforced configuration appears below.

config for hawep-taweg:
[frair]
port = 8443
region = west-3
host = frair.sivrelhq.internal
team = oliael
timeout_ms = 1000
retries = 2

**Checklist item — query planner regression (Varnholt release 4.2)**

Before sign-off, confirm the planner no longer falls back to sequential scans on partitioned joins, the regression Priya flagged last Thursday. Run the full Quillstone benchmark suite twice, compare plan hashes against the 4.1 baseline, and attach the diff to the sync notes. If any plan diverges, hold the release and escalate to the storage pod. Verified against the following build:

session token of yajof-bagef = htk4_937d

Subject: On-call handover — orders soft deletes

Hi Marek,

Quick note before you take over. We shipped the soft-delete change to the Cartwheel orders table last night: rows now get a deleted_at timestamp instead of being removed. Plugin authors querying orders directly must filter on deleted_at IS NULL, or they'll see ghost orders. The compat view orders_active handles this automatically. Docs are updated in the Cartwheel developer portal. If plugin authors hit anything weird, route them to the integrations inbox.

escalation mailbox, tafop-fahif: oliael@tolvaqlabs.corp